How much does it cost to rent a home in Miami?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Miami 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,416 | $1,300 | $10,000+ |
Miami 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,390 | $1,950 | $10,000+ |
Miami 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$9,908 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
Miami 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$19,610 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
Miami 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$33,803 | $2,275 | $10,000+ |
Miami 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$36,282 | $8,900 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Miami
What type of rentals are currently available in Miami?
There are currently 13426 Apartments for Rent in Miami, FL with pricing that ranges from $745 to $50,000. There are also 9759 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Miami ranging from $800 to $100,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Miami?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Miami ranges from $800 to $100,000 with an average monthly rent of $26,398.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Miami?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Miami range from $847 to $30,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,950 to $70,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,200 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,150.
